Volleyball Hangs On to Defeat TAMIU 3-2

The University of Texas of the Permian Basin volleyball team wrapped up a 2-0 weekend with its second five-set victory in three days in a 21-25, 25-12, 25-27, 25-16 and 15-10 win over Texas A&M International Saturday afternoon in Laredo, Texas.

With their backs against the wall having dropped a tightly-contested third set to trail 2-1, the Falcons came out ready to play in the fourth. UTPB fought back from trailing 5-2 to lead 7-5 on five straight points that included three service aces from Ariana Gallardo. Behind 12-11 a few points later, the Falcons rattled off eight of nine to lead 19-13, and broken up by a Dustdevils point, UTPB scored three more consecutive points to take a commanding 22-14 lead. Keeley Brogdon closed out the nine-point fourth set win with a pair of kills to head to a decisive fifth set.

UTPB carried the momentum into the fifth, again having to recover from trailing early on, this time 4-2 in the abbreviated set, to come back to take a 6-5 lead. The Falcons then closed out the set on a 9-5 run to claim the five-set win.

Melissa Lusk led the Falcons in kills for the fourth straight match with a match-best 16 kills on the afternoon while hitting .310. Terra Peil added 14 kills with an incredible .538 hitting percentage as the Falcons out-hit the Dustdevils .230 to .138 for the match.

Ariel Fralick totaled 32 assists to lead the Falcons, and Taylor Harmon had 30 digs on the day for UTPB. 

The Falcons are back home this coming week, hosting Oklahoma Panhandle State Thursday night at 7 p.m.
